Microsoft Dynamics AX is an integrated enterprise resource planning system offering extensive modules for finance, logistics, and manufacturing. Known for its Excel integration and competitive pricing, it provides companies with flexible and customizable workflows for efficient business processes.
Microsoft Dynamics AX provides comprehensive support for manufacturing, retail, and financial management. Its centralized structure ensures effective data management and smooth workflow automation, while integration with third-party applications allows for real-time analysis and customization. Although there is a need for improved APIs, a more modern interface, and robust financial features, Dynamics AX supports a varied range of business operations with its cloud and on-premise setups. The system has some security limitations and performance challenges, and its reliance on Power BI for real-time analytics highlights areas for development, especially for on-premise users.
